Critics and fans praised the game for its fluid movement, precise controls, and high difficulty curve. It is a title that demands mastery, featuring complex "Shinespark" puzzles and aggressive boss fights that require pattern recognition and reflexes. In the years following its release, Metroid Dread has solidified its status as a must-play title on the hybrid console, setting a new standard for the franchise's future.
